Job Title: Tax Senior Associate II
Job Responsibilities:
- Provide tax compliance, tax provision, and tax advisory services to pass-through and C-corporation entities. The focus is on companies in industries such as manufacturing and distribution, construction and real estate, professional services and technology, and financial institutions.
- Assist in supervising, developing, and coaching professional tax staff, ensuring their growth and adherence to company standards.
- Develop and manage client relationships, ensuring that client service is timely and exceeds expectations.
- Represent the company in the marketplace by attending networking events to foster relationships and promote the brand.
- Participate in the proposal process for potential new clients, contributing to the company’s business development efforts.
- Engage in campus recruiting initiatives and programs to attract new talent to the company.
- Contribute to company-sponsored technical guidance for internal and external publications, and participate in internal learning and development sessions.
- Work collaboratively with the team to assign projects and resolve scheduling conflicts efficiently.
Education and Experience Information:
- Minimum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in accounting, finance, or a related field.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ite.
- At least 2 years of relevant progressive tax experience in public accounting or a combination of corporate tax and public accounting experience.
- CPA license or fulfillment of the educational requirements necessary to obtain a CPA license (150-credit hour requirement).
- Preferred Qualifications:
- Master’s degree in Accounting, Taxation, Law degree, or a related field.
- Experience in Private Equity and Partnerships.
